Circle of Jacopo Negretti, called Palma il Giovane (Venice circa 1550-1628)
The Holy Trinity worshipped by the Virgin Mary and the Baptist, three martyr saints and Saint Charles Borromeo (recto); Studies of an angel appearing to a female saint, the bust of a Roman, Mary Magdalene, heads, noses and ears (verso)
with inscriptions 'Palma' (recto and verso) and numbers (verso)
traces of black chalk, pen and brown ink, brown wash on brown paper (recto and verso), heightened with white, squared in black chalk (recto)
14 ¼ x 9 ½ in. (36.2 x 24.1 cm)

Possibly Daniel Burckhardt-Wild (1759-1819), Basel.
Professor Dr Daniel Burckhardt-Werthemann, Basel.
with Claude Kuhn, Basel, 1988 (this and the above according to the Landolt typescript catalogue), from whom acquired by Robert Landolt.
